Перейти к контенту

[2.1.x]Модераторские теги


Рекомендуемые сообщения

Название: Модераторские теги

Добавил: OverHerz

Добавлен: 14 Янв 2007

Обновлен: 21 Янв 2007

Категория: IP.Board 2.1.x

 

Адаптация модераторских тегов от Giv'a под 2.1.х

 

1) два вида тегов - [mod] и [ex]

2) после добавления тегов в сообщение пользователя, пользователь не может его править

3) изменение через css

4) доступны только админам и модераторам

 

Добавления версии 1.1

5) в сообщении указывается имя модератора

6) исправлена ошибка с исправлением модератором своего сообщения не в своем разделе

7) кнопки на панели

 

Версия 1.1.5 - исправлена ошибка с пунктом 2

Версия 1.2 - структура переписана на дивы, что позволило убрать ошибку в IE

 

Версия 1.2.5 - исправлена ошибка с отображением кнопок на панели в RTE форме ответа

 

Нажмите здесь, чтобы скачать файл

Ссылка на комментарий
Поделиться на других сайтах

  • Ответы 283
  • Создана
  • Последний ответ

Лучшие авторы в этой теме

ну наконец-то! :D

спасибо,

вот только есть впоросик, можно ли сделать так что бы буковка М или ! были бы слева? то есть сначала Буква, а потом надпись, строгое предупреждение?

То есть МСтрогое предупреждение модератора

Ссылка на комментарий
Поделиться на других сайтах

Ага, спасибо за мод!

 

вот только есть впоросик, можно ли сделать так что бы буковка М или ! были бы слева? то есть сначала Буква, а потом надпись, строгое предупреждение?

То есть МСтрогое предупреждение модератора

когда стили добавляешь, то вместо right напиши left

 

background: #E4EAF2 url(<#IMG_DIR#>/mod.gif) no-repeat left;

и

background: #E4EAF2 url(<#IMG_DIR#>/ex.gif) no-repeat left;

 

добавить в классы css "mod_up" и "ex_up" строку

padding-left: 20px;

 

Должно так сработать)

Ссылка на комментарий
Поделиться на других сайтах

так же в эти теги нельзя поставить смайлики, хотя для сообщения(не для предупреждение) я думаю это было бы уместно.

 

ps: а для 2.2.х будет мод переделываться?

Ссылка на комментарий
Поделиться на других сайтах

а можно сделать ещё типо админские тэги? тоже самое, только вместо М, поставить А и надписи изменить???
Ссылка на комментарий
Поделиться на других сайтах

ps: а для 2.2.х будет мод переделываться?

пока 2.2 в глаза не видел

 

Ещё бы добавить имя давшего замечание модератора.

уже сделал, будет в след. версии

 

Может сделать ещё кнопки, чтобы были доступны только модерам и админам?

будут

 

а можно сделать ещё типо админские тэги? тоже самое, только вместо М, поставить А и надписи изменить???

 

а смысл? если кому-то еще нужно, то сделаю

 

 

так же в эти теги нельзя поставить смайлики, хотя для сообщения(не для предупреждение) я думаю это было бы уместно.

в ф-и regex_mod_tag закоментируй парсер вот так:

 

				  /*
		   	//$txt = str_replace( "&" , "&", $txt );
			$txt = preg_replace( "#<#"   , "<", $txt );
			$txt = preg_replace( "#>#"   , ">", $txt );
			$txt = preg_replace( "#"#" , """, $txt );
			$txt = preg_replace( "#:#"	  , ":", $txt );
			$txt = preg_replace( "#\[#"	 , "[", $txt );
			$txt = preg_replace( "#\]#"	 , "]", $txt );
			$txt = preg_replace( "#\)#"	 , ")", $txt );
			$txt = preg_replace( "#\(#"	 , "(", $txt );
			$txt = preg_replace( "#\r#"	 , "<br>", $txt );
			$txt = preg_replace( "#\n#"	 , "<br>", $txt );
			$txt = preg_replace( "#\s{1};#" , ";", $txt );
											  */

Ссылка на комментарий
Поделиться на других сайтах

Ещё бы добавить имя давшего замечание модератора.

уже сделал, будет в след. версии

оперативность впечатляет :D а как насчет моих вопросиков?

картинка в лево подвинулась, но вот текст почему-то нет :) все время так и стоит около левой стеночки :)

текст идет поверх картинки

 

упс видимо дописали пока писал я ;)

Ссылка на комментарий
Поделиться на других сайтах

картинка в лево подвинулась, но вот текст почему-то нет :D все время так и стоит около левой стеночки ;)

ну блин.. так он же слева и стоит, зачем его опять влево двигать? чет ты не то сказал)))

 

Если текст накладывается на картинку... то ты забыл добавить что я писал про классы.

 

добавить в классы css "mod_up" и "ex_up" строку

padding-left: 20px;

 

20px - отрегулируй сам)

Ссылка на комментарий
Поделиться на других сайтах

так же в эти теги нельзя поставить смайлики, хотя для сообщения(не для предупреждение) я думаю это было бы уместно.

в ф-и regex_mod_tag закоментируй парсер вот так:

 

				  /*
		   	//$txt = str_replace( "&" , "&", $txt );
			$txt = preg_replace( "#<#"   , "<", $txt );
			$txt = preg_replace( "#>#"   , ">", $txt );
			$txt = preg_replace( "#"#" , """, $txt );
			$txt = preg_replace( "#:#"	  , ":", $txt );
			$txt = preg_replace( "#\[#"	 , "[", $txt );
			$txt = preg_replace( "#\]#"	 , "]", $txt );
			$txt = preg_replace( "#\)#"	 , ")", $txt );
			$txt = preg_replace( "#\(#"	 , "(", $txt );
			$txt = preg_replace( "#\r#"	 , "<br>", $txt );
			$txt = preg_replace( "#\n#"	 , "<br>", $txt );
			$txt = preg_replace( "#\s{1};#" , ";", $txt );
											  */

Спасибо, помогло но не совсем ;) рисуется только один смайлик почему-то :)

http://img260.imageshack.us/img260/4223/modtegeditedkk7.jpg

 

да, твое решение для того что бы подвинуть текст помогло, на рисунке значение в 50 пикселей

 

картинка в лево подвинулась, но вот текст почему-то нет :) все время так и стоит около левой стеночки :)

ну блин.. так он же слева и стоит, зачем его опять влево двигать? чет ты не то сказал)))

 

Если текст накладывается на картинку... то ты забыл добавить что я писал про классы.

 

добавить в классы css "mod_up" и "ex_up" строку

padding-left: 20px;

 

20px - отрегулируй сам)

Я сначала попробовал, потом отписал получилось вот что при добавлениях в классах в форуме

количество пикселей ничего не меняло! Вот как получилось.

 

http://img144.imageshack.us/img144/3965/modteg23jd2.jpg

 

ps: картинку для сообщения переделал сам, цвет текста в рамочке предупреждения меняется в настройках css в форуме.

 

OverHerz, а когда ожидается обновление?

ну подожди немного сейчас народ потестит, найдет большую часть недостатков и автор обновит модификацию, когда учтет пожелания :D

Ссылка на комментарий
Поделиться на других сайтах

а когда ожидается обновление?

скоро, пока сделал указание имени модератора (работает как в quote, т.е [mod=OverHerz].... ), исправил ошибку с редактированием (сообщение двоилось)

 

из замеченных проблем - модератор после использования тегов не в своем разделе, не может потом отредактировать собственное сообщение... тут либо запрещать юзать не в своих разделах либо просто исправить...

Ссылка на комментарий
Поделиться на других сайтах

Ещё бы исключить эти теги из цитирования...

кстати да, весомое замечание.

 

ps: завтра или в выходные попробую на 2.2.1 поставить авось ниче менять не придется :D

Ссылка на комментарий
Поделиться на других сайтах

Мод обновил

 

инструкции по обновлению не будет, потому что поменял почти все. Чтобы обновиться сносите старую версию и ставьте новую.

Ссылка на комментарий
Поделиться на других сайтах

А можно сделать чтобы "Сообщение от модератора" зависило от группы.. например "Сообщение от администратора" или "Сообщение от Супермодератора" .. что нить типо того.. м? =)

А то делает замечание админ, а написано от модератора... -\

 

 

akura

2) после добавления тегов в сообщение пользователя, пользователь не может его править
Ссылка на комментарий
Поделиться на других сайтах

всё работает, только юзер может после, всё отредактировать. нелогично!

как уже подметил TOIIOP - не может

 

А можно сделать чтобы "Сообщение от модератора" зависило от группы.. например "Сообщение от администратора" или "Сообщение от Супермодератора" .. что нить типо того.. м? =)А то делает замечание админ, а написано от модератора... -\

 

Можно просто удалить "модератора", тогда будет "Сообщение от #ник#" :D

 

хотя можно и как ты хочешь, это нетрудно...

Ссылка на комментарий
Поделиться на других сайтах

×
×
  • Создать...

Важная информация

Находясь на нашем сайте, вы соглашаетесь на использование файлов cookie, а также с нашим положением о конфиденциальности Политика конфиденциальности и пользовательским соглашением Условия использования.